""The Protestant: Or Negative Faith Refuted; And The Catholic: Or Affirmative Faith Demonstrated From Scripture"" is a book written by William P. MacDonald in 1843. The book is a theological work that seeks to refute the negative faith of Protestantism and demonstrate the affirmative faith of Catholicism through the use of scripture. MacDonald argues that the Protestant faith is based on a rejection of Catholic teachings rather than a positive affirmation of its own beliefs, and that this negative approach is flawed. He then provides a detailed analysis of various biblical passages to demonstrate the superiority of Catholic teachings. The book is aimed at a Christian audience and seeks to persuade readers to convert to Catholicism.
